Who funds Verde Inc?
Verde Inc is funded by 48 grantmakers, led by Meyer Memorial Trust ($1.7M), The Schmidt Family Foundation ($700K), United States Energy Foundation ($673K). In total, IRS Form 990 filings record $8.0M in grants to Verde Inc between 2020–2024.

Who is Verde Inc's largest funder?
Meyer Memorial Trust is the largest recorded funder of Verde Inc, with $1.7M across 22 grants (2020–2024).
How much grant funding has Verde Inc received?
IRS 990 filings record $8.0M in grants to Verde Inc across 118 grants from 48 funders between 2020–2024. Filings are published on a delay, so recent grants may not appear yet.
